Output df7ce7884f7367939129bca62bbbafaf861f696ef29fb3a7a24ea17e5c3f8808:0

value
45382
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1c91d7928beff6f914d19884f362416828bcdc21 OP_EQUAL
address
34J5ZCaH1QiaS4pWecs7tWDMrzpXYcaqVd
transaction
df7ce7884f7367939129bca62bbbafaf861f696ef29fb3a7a24ea17e5c3f8808
confirmations
135373
spent
true